JavaScript is not enabled.
Fresh, fast and tasty - Review by citysearch c | Ha Ha Pizza

Ha Ha Pizza

Claim

Fresh, fast and tasty 3/17/2008

If you want to experience eating excellent pizza, then you will want to try Ha Ha pizza in Yellow Springs, Ohio. Their pizza is made with the finest fresh ingredients one will not want to pass up. Pros: Friendly, fresh and great environment more
Summer SALE!!!:
15% OFF all yearly plans
Use year15 at checkout. Expires 1/1/2021